A few weeks ago, I will click on random things in less traveled websites, i.e. not Amazon or most large seller websites, it will instantly add a new popup and send me to a 'weevah2....' website, or 'oneclicktop.com...', or 'liveadexchanger.com...'. Obviously phishing or scam sites, but even WITH popup blocker on, it still opens a new tab to these sites. Sometimes, it does not even open a new tab, but redirects the page when I click on a link within the site. I have both Norton and Windows Defender and they don't seem to fix the problem. I have done repeated scans with both. Firefox is up to date. I am also running Ghostry and a cookie killer. Anyone know what to do??

hi, next to the security software already in place, please run a scan with various other security tools like the free version of malwarebytes, adwcleaner & eset online one-time scanner - they are moe focused on browser hijackers and might find adware that went under the radar of norton.
